
Krotevič
Krotevič is a prominent Ukrainian soldier and veteran of the Azov regiment, known for his outspoken criticism of the Ukrainian military leadership. After resigning as the chief of staff for the Azov brigade in February 2023, he has publicly called for the resignation of top military officials, including Commander-in-Chief Oleksandr Sirski, citing concerns over dangerous orders that put soldiers at risk. Krotevič gained notoriety for his role during the siege of the Azovstal steel plant in Mariupol in 2022 and his subsequent return to the front lines after being held as a prisoner of war. His recent remarks to the Guardian highlight his frustration with the current military strategy and command, underscoring the need for reform in Ukraine's military leadership.
